American Airlines, Qantas To Add New Flights Between US And Australia
(RTTNews) - American Airlines (AAL) and Qantas Airways on Tuesday said they plan to significantly expand their joint business by adding new service between the U.S. and Australia.
New routes between Los Angeles International Airport and Sydney Airport, operated by American Airlines, and between San Francisco International Airport and Sydney Airport, operated by Qantas, will provide customers with expanded options when traveling between the two regions, the airline companies said.
Through this enhanced alliance, American Airlines will begin operating a daily, nonstop flight between Los Angeles International Airport and Sydney Airport on December 17, 2015. Beginning December 20, 2015 Qantas will begin operating service between Sydney Airport and San Francisco International Airport.
Services will initially operate on peak days and ramp up to six times per week in January 2016, the companies said.
The closer and more integrated relationship also provides opportunities for future growth into trans-Pacific markets not currently served by either airline, such as New Zealand, the companies said.
